Bramley (Hampshire) to Cheltenham Spa by train

A train trip from Bramley (Hampshire) to Cheltenham Spa takes about 2hrs 31 mins on average, covering roughly 59 miles (95 kilometres). With around 31 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£15.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bramley (Hampshire) to Cheltenham Spa start from as little as £15.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bramley (Hampshire) to Cheltenham Spa start from £31.80 one way, or £55.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bramley (Hampshire) to Cheltenham Spa are available for £88.90 one way, or £177.80 return

Facilities and Amenities

Bramley station is equipped with several essential facilities to make your travel experience seamless. If you need to purchase tickets, a ticket office is available with convenient opening hours from Monday to Saturday. For those who prefer a more automated service, ticket machines are present and accessible. You'll also be pleased to find an induction loop facility ensuring clear communication for hearing-impaired passengers.

While Bramley may not boast extensive amenities such as shops or restaurants, it does cater to basic needs. There are waiting rooms with seating areas on both platforms, ensuring you have a comfortable space to wait for your train. For any assistance, staff help is available during morning hours throughout the week, and CCTV cameras help maintain a safe environment.

Accessibility & Onward Travel

Bramley (Hampshire) station is committed to accessibility, providing step-free access to platforms via a level crossing—classified as a Category B1 station. Although ticket barriers aren't present, this arrangement ensures ease for those with mobility challenges. Despite lacking accessible taxis or dedicated drop-off points, passengers requiring assistance can request arrangements up to two hours before their journey through the Passenger Assist program.

For onward travel, rail replacement services are conveniently located on Sherfield Road for directions to Reading and Basingstoke. While direct taxi services aren't available, nearby public transportation can be planned with resources like [this helpful poster](http://www.nationalrail.co.uk/posters/BMY.pdf).

A Hub of Facilities and Amenities

Cheltenham Spa is equipped with a robust ticketing service, featuring both manned ticket offices and machines for purchasing and collecting tickets with ease.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 20:15 on weekdays, slightly altering times over the weekend. Furthermore, smartcards can be issued at this station, though they lack on-site validators.

Accessibility is made a priority at this station, with step-free access to platforms via ramps, and there are provisions for customers needing extra assistance with a dedicated help point. For those carrying heavy luggage, it's important to note that there isn’t a luggage storage facility available. However, customer service staff are on hand from 05:00 to 01:00 daily to assist whenever needed.

Parking is handled by APCOA Parking, offering 286 spaces, 17 of which are wheelchair-accessible. Though the car park is monitored, it doesn't feature CCTV. The rates are reasonable and include a variety of payment plans to suit different needs. Meanwhile, cyclists can benefit from 134 cycle storage spaces and hire services offered by Compass Holidays.

Seamless Connectivity Beyond the Platform

Cheltenham Spa station serves as a critical intersection for various modes of transport besides trains, easing the transition from rail to other transport forms. In case of rail service disruptions, a replacement service is available just in front of the station. Taxis are conveniently stationed at the entrance, though an accessible taxi requires a staff member's help to arrange.

For avid cyclists, bike hire is operational on the platform, offering excellent routes and experiences through Compass Holidays. While those keen on exploring surroundings can access local bus services, with comprehensive onwards travel information available to download in a printable format.
